On Sun, Aug 06, 2017 at 06:43:56PM +0200, Mikko Rapeli wrote:
> Fixes userspace compilation error:
> 
> error: unknown type name ‘size_t’
> 
> Signed-off-by: Mikko Rapeli <mikko.rap...@iki.fi>
> Cc: Arnd Bergmann <a...@arndb.de>
> Cc: David S. Miller <da...@davemloft.net>
> ---
>  include/uapi/linux/sysctl.h | 4 ++--
>  1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/include/uapi/linux/sysctl.h b/include/uapi/linux/sysctl.h
> index e13d48058b8d..35a4b8b417fe 100644
> --- a/include/uapi/linux/sysctl.h
> +++ b/include/uapi/linux/sysctl.h
> @@ -35,9 +35,9 @@ struct __sysctl_args {
>       int __user *name;
>       int nlen;
>       void __user *oldval;
> -     size_t __user *oldlenp;
> +     __kernel_size_t __user *oldlenp;
>       void __user *newval;
> -     size_t newlen;
> +     __kernel_size_t newlen;
>       unsigned long __unused[4];
>  };

You should be extremely careful when replacing size_t with __kernel_size_t
because e.g. on x32 you have sizeof(size_t) < sizeof(__kernel_size_t).

In case of sysctl.h this replacement would be wrong.

I submitted an alternative fix for this bug some time ago, see
http://lkml.kernel.org/r/20170222230652.ga14...@altlinux.org
